one. What's a fire alarm program? A fire alarm system is a group of initiating gadgets, appliances, and Command panels that detect fires, notify constructing occupants, deal with possibility and notify very first responders from the centrally managed and monitored locale.

Beam detectors are very best used in vast open locations like shipping warehouses, sporting arenas and concert halls, as they may have wider coverage than other alarm types and might precisely discern involving smoke and other kinds of obstructions.

A pull station is probably the fire alarm procedure ingredient you’re most accustomed to. It’s a manually operated unit that initiates an alarm signal when another person pulls its cope with. While smoke may possibly acquire a few minutes to achieve a smoke detector, you can activate a pull station within just a few seconds of the fire or other emergency, which permits a faster evacuation and a lot quicker reaction situations through the fire Division. Pull stations are available in different sizes and shapes and may come with protective handles on request. 4.
